Milk (Urban Council) Bylaws

[1989 Ed.

[Subsidiary]

8.

Ingredient not to be added to cream

No person shall sell for human consumption any cream to which an ingredient other than one specified in item 12 of the First Schedule to the Food and Drugs (Composition and Labelling) Regulations (Cap.132 sub. leg.) has been added, and no such ingredient shall be added in an amount in excess of that permitted by that item.

9. Milk not to be sold except in approved containers

(L.N. 347 of 1989)

No person shall sell any milk for human consumption save in containers of a type approved by the Council:

Provided that the provisions of this bylaw shall not apply to milk which is sold by wholesale to a milk factory.

10. (Repealed L.N. 32 of 1967)

11. As to beverages resembling, etc. milk

(1) No person shall sell for human consumption-

(a) any milk beverage; (L.N. 259 of 1977)

(b) any beverage which is described for the purpose of sale by any name, trade mark or trade description which includes the word "milk" or "cream" or the Chinese characters "" or “” or any word or character implying that such beverage is or contains milk or cream; or

(c) any soya bean juice or coconut juice (except in whole coconuts) or any other beverage which resembles milk either in colour, taste, appearance or consistency,

unless it is contained in a container of a type approved by the Council. (L.N. 32 of 1967)

(2) The provisions of paragraph (1) shall not apply to any beverage specified in that paragraph which is sold for human consumption on premises in respect of which a licence has been granted by the Council under the Food Business (Urban Council) By-laws (Cap.132 sub. leg.) so long as such beverage is not sold under any description which is false or misleading as to the true nature of its principal ingredients. (10 of 1986 s. 32(2))

12. Precautions against contamination of milk, etc.

Every person in possession for the purpose of sale of any milk or any of the beverages specified in bylaw 11(1) shall take all reasonable and proper precautions to prevent infection or contamination thereof.
